First of all, I assume you are kidding about a reverse. If not, you should have your head checked. Secondly, the issue at HYSL has not been overstaffing or bloated expenses. It has been the lack of a successful integration of sales forces, resulting in slower sales the last 2 or three quarters. Definitely the company has staffed up over the last 6 months, but I'm not sure if they are overstaffed. Once there is evidence of execution of the integration, the stock will rise. Without it, we sit here or drift.

The one potential catalyst is that the company is seeking a new CEO. Depending upon who that is, there may be some kind of rally. However, speculation (and I mean purely speculation) is that the company could also be an acquisition candidate.
